GLOBALDAIRYTRADE<br />
In 2008, <strong>Fonterra</strong> established an auction<br />
platform for internationally-traded commodity<br />
dairy products called GlobalDairyTrade<br />
(GDT). GDT has become a leading global<br />
price reference indicator for the products<br />
traded. GDT prices are increasingly used as<br />
the basis for calculating the Farmgate Milk<br />
Price that <strong>Fonterra</strong> pays farmers for milk in<br />
New Zeal<strong>and</strong>.<br />
GDT now includes other global dairy<br />
vendors, with DairyAmerica the first to<br />
join in October 2011. Murray Goulburn (an<br />
established Australian dairy co-operative)<br />
<strong>and</strong> Arla Foods joined in 2012. In FY2012,<br />
NZ Milk Products generated approximately<br />
30% of its sales through this platform, which<br />
represented over 95% of total GDT sales.<br />
<strong>Fonterra</strong> is able to achieve higher margins<br />
through the management of product mix<br />
<strong>and</strong> obtaining prices that are above those<br />
generated on GDT for the five Reference<br />
Commodity Products used in calculating the<br />
Farmgate Milk Price (for further information,<br />
see the text box entitled “Summary of Setting<br />
the Farmgate Milk Price for New Zeal<strong>and</strong><br />
milk”). Accordingly, to the extent possible,<br />
<strong>Fonterra</strong> seeks to achieve an optimal product<br />
mix to enhance returns across NZ Milk<br />
Products <strong>and</strong> its regional businesses. For<br />
further details, please refer to Section 3 –<br />
Setting the Farmgate Milk Price for New<br />
Zeal<strong>and</strong> Milk.<br />
While New Zeal<strong>and</strong>-sourced milk is the<br />
cornerstone of <strong>Fonterra</strong>’s milk production,<br />
growth in global dem<strong>and</strong> for dairy presents<br />
an opportunity for <strong>Fonterra</strong> to develop secure<br />
sources of quality milk outside New Zeal<strong>and</strong>.<br />
<strong>Fonterra</strong> intends to supplement its New<br />
Zeal<strong>and</strong> production with high-quality in<br />
market milk production for its offshore<br />
customers.<br />
OVERVIEW OF GLOBALDAIRYTRADE (GDT)<br />
GDT TM currently provides a market place<br />
for eight different product groups:<br />
• Whole milk powder<br />
• Skim milk powder<br />
• Anhydrous milk fat<br />
• Buttermilk powder<br />
• Casein<br />
• Lactose<br />
• Milk protein concentrate<br />
• Cheddar<br />
GDT TM trading events are conducted as<br />
ascending-price clock auctions run over<br />
several bidding rounds. In each auction a<br />
specified maximum quantity of each<br />
product is offered for sale at a preannounced<br />
starting price. Bidders bid the<br />
quantity of each product that they wish to<br />
purchase at the announced price. If the price<br />
of a product increases between rounds,<br />
to ensure their desired quantity a bidder<br />
must bid their desired quantity at the new,<br />
higher price. Generally, as the price of a<br />
product increases, the quantity of bids<br />
received for that product decreases. The<br />
trading event runs over several rounds with<br />
the prices increasing round to round until<br />
the quantity of bids received for each<br />
product on offer matches the quantity on<br />
offer for the product (as illustrated in the<br />
diagram 1 ). Each trading event typically last<br />
approximately two hours.<br />
While GDT is owned by <strong>Fonterra</strong> it is<br />
operated at arm’s length, <strong>and</strong> is open to<br />
other suppliers. GDT is operated by<br />
Charles River Associates. To date<br />
DairyAmerica, Murray Goulburn <strong>and</strong> Arla<br />
Foods have also sold product on GDT.<br />
Updated contractual arrangements to<br />
reflect this evolution to a multi-seller<br />
platform are in the final stages of negotiation<br />
with Charles River Associates.<br />
